Safe Guard

Description:

Safe Guard refers to a protective measure taken to ensure safety, security, or protection from harm. It can be used as a noun or a verb.

Senses:

Noun:

  1. A precautionary measure or action taken to prevent possible danger or risk.
  2. A person or group responsible for ensuring safety or security.
  3. An official endorsement or stamp on a document to indicate its authenticity.

Verb:

To provide protection or security to someone or something.

Usages:

  1. The safe guard on the machine prevented any accidents from occurring.
  2. We have hired security to act as the safe guard of the premises.
  3. The document required a safe guard to prove its originality.
  4. It is our duty to safe guard the privacy of our customers.
